New Information on AMD Navi 48 and Navi 44 GPUs

The leaks about AMD’s next-generation Radeon RX 8000 series graphics cards keep coming and new information sheds light on the memory bandwidth, Infinity Cache and VRAM speeds of the Navi 48 and Navi 44 GPUs. A recent Geekbench listing showed a high-end Navi 48-powered graphics card, possibly the Radeon RX 8700 XT or its variant. Given that this card has 56 CUs, it hints at the true power of the RX 8700 XT.

New Information on AMD Navi 48 and Navi 44 GPUs Revealed

A cryptic Tweet shared by an X user named @all_the_watts revealed details of four different SKUs belonging to the RDNA 4 family. These include:

  • Navi 48 GPU, 256-bit bus, 64 MB Infinity Cache, 20 Gbps VRAM
  • Navi 48 GPU, 256-bit bus, 64 MB Infinity Cache, 18 Gbps VRAM
  • Navi 48 GPU, 192-bit bus, 48 MB Infinity Cache, 19 Gbps VRAM
  • Navi 44 GPU, 128-bit bus, 32 MB Infinity Cache, 18 Gbps VRAM

These leaks coincide with earlier reports by @Kepler_L2 that the Navi 48 SKUs will have 64 MB Infinity Cache on the higher-end models and 48 MB on the lower-end models. AMD’s next-gen GPUs will likely compete head-to-head with Nvidia’s GeForce RTX 4080 in rasterization performance. According to YouTuber Moore’s Law is Dead, at least one RDNA 4 SKU will launch with 64 CUs.
